64: Can of Peach Oolong Tea 64: Can of Peach Oolong Tea While the city celebrated, Hao took a moment to check his progress on the system task.
There were still more products to be sold before the task could be finished.
As for the spicy version of the instant noodles, it had been warmly welcomed to the store.
The time it landed in the hands of the cultivators, their reactions were nothing short of entertaining.
The fiery flavor hit them with an intense heat, making some pause, while others immediately reached for more.
Those used to enduring pain grinned as they swallowed, the spice adding a thrilling kick to their meal.
The noodles quickly became a favorite, especially among the younger crowd, who enjoyed the challenge of the heat.
However, the older cultivators weren’t so impressed.
They preferred the original, familiar taste, arguing that the spice only masked the true flavor.
The debate quickly grew into a spirited discussion between the generations.
Was the spicy version a new challenge to savor, or did the classic still reign supreme?
For now, a truce was reached, with both sides agreeing that each version had its place.
But the spicy instant noodles had certainly made their mark, sparking lively conversation and leaving a lasting impression.
Of course, Hao was a fan.
Even if the only “mythical effect” he experienced was the burning hell that awaited him the next time he visited the restroom.
The days passed, and the regular customers continued to visit, but no new ones showed up.
Hao, Kurome, and Mo Xixi remained busy with their daily jobs.
Life moved at a steady pace – just the regular cycle of selling and restocking.
But finally, after what felt like an eternity, Hao received a notification from the system.
He immediately checked it – the main task had been completed, and so had the first side task!
Hao claimed the reward.
New products would be arriving soon – Peach Oolong Tea and Original Salted Potato Chips.
This was entirely new to the store, and Hao couldn’t help but feel a spark of excitement.
As for the last task… well, he still hadn’t found a potential store guardian to recruit.
But that was for another day.
Hao had a tight sleep, the kind where he was half awake, half dreaming of new products.
He woke up early, rushing downstairs.
The new cartons had arrived!
He jumped into unboxing mode.
Hao tore open the first box, and there they were… Bags of Original Salted Potato Chips!

The bags were pristine white, with “Potato Chips” boldly printed at the top.
Just below it, in smaller letters, was “Original Salted.” Towards the center, near the lower part of the bag, an illustration of thin, perfectly fried potato slices caught the eye.
They were golden brown and crisped to perfection, each slice delicate and airy, On the lower half of the bag, an illustration depicted thin, perfectly fried potato slices – golden brown and crisped to perfection.
Each slice appeared delicate and airy, with a light dusting of salt that shimmered enticingly.
The bag crinkled in Hao’s hand as he gave it a slight shake.
Crunch.
Something whispered in the back of his mind.
The urge to tear the bag open, to indulge in the crispy, salty goodness inside.
One bite won’t hurt.
You’ve waited long enough.
‘Let’s check the oolong tea first.’ Hao resisted, pushing the temptation aside.
He moved over to the other box and opened it.
Inside, the cans of Peach Oolong Tea were neatly stacked.
Just like the Cola and Lime Fizz cans, they were the same size and dimensions, but the design was completely different.
The can was a soft, pastel pink, almost like the color of a light sunset.
The words “Peach Oolong Tea” were printed in bold, black letters across the center.
Below the text, an illustration of a ripe peach graced the can, its vibrant orange hue standing out against the soft pink backdrop.
Next to it, a halved peach was depicted, its white, juicy interior visible, with a delicate leaf resting beside it, completing the refreshing design.
Hao picked up one can of Peach Oolong Tea, rotating it.
‘Never had this on Earth.
But hey, looks like it’s gonna be pretty refreshing.’ The lingering burn of the spicy noodles from yesterday made his throat feel dry.
He was thirsty, and this could be just what he needed.
Without waiting any longer, he cracked the can open.
A faint hiss escaped, but unlike the fizzy drinks he was used to, this one wasn’t carbonated.
The smoothness of it made him feel relaxed, like a gentle breeze on a hot day.
Hao brought the can to his nose first, inhaling deeply.
The delicate fragrance of peach and something floral filled his senses, not too strong, but enough to make him look forward to that first sip.
He raised the can to his lips and took a drink.
The taste hit him right away.
It was a perfect balance between sweet and floral, but not overpowering.
The peach flavor wasn’t the overly sugary kind he had expected.
Instead, it was subtle, almost like the fresh, natural taste of peach without that heavy sweetness.
The bitterness of the oolong tea blended perfectly with the peach essence, creating a smooth, calming sensation.
Hao squinted at the can design.
‘This… could it be the white peach that makes it less sweet?’ ‘I’ve only ever had yellow peaches back on Earth.
Maybe that’s why this one’s not as sugary?’ He took another sip, feeling the cool liquid slide down.
The heat from the spicy noodles was long gone, replaced by the refreshing chill of the tea.
‘This is good.’ Hao said with a satisfied smile.
‘Not too sweet.
Just right.’ ‘If all Peach Oolong Tea tastes like this, I’m in.
I could get used to this.’ In fact, this could be his new substitute for the two sugary soft drinks he used to rely on.
Forget Cola and Lime Fizz – this was the real deal now!
Setting the can aside, Hao reached for a bag of Original Salted Potato Chips.
Chips for breakfast?
Who cares?
He was the store owner!
His thoughts shifted briefly to his parents, would definitely lecture him if they saw him eating chips at this hour.
But what could they do?
They weren’t here, so he could do whatever he wanted.
